>> Hey all,
>> 
>> I'm working with Stephen Farrell who is part of the IETF TLS Working
>> Group, with a current focus on ESNI.  We're wondering how much interest
>> there is here in TLSv1.3 Encrypt SNI extension that is currently an IETF
>> draft implemented by Firefox, Cloudflare, and others.  We could
>> potentially submit code to make trafficserver support ESNI.  We are
>> currently working on getting ESNI implemented in openssl.
